Lack of support from NGOs

When I was assigned as a legislative staff of one of the senators in the Senate, one of our routine tasks was to draft bills and resolutions to be filed by our senator.

I remember we drafted many bills related to information and technology, namely a bill on cybercrime prevention and a bill on defining and penalizing cybersex.

As of even date, none of these bills have been approved. I think we are not lacking in legislation when it comes to information and technology. I think what is lacking is support and consistent lobbying for the passage the bills.

During committee hearings in the senate, where I myself acted as committee officer in charge, I noticed that when bills in IT were being discussed, only representatives from DOST and members of the academe were usually present.

Maybe it can be a big help if more NGOs would lobby for IT related bills in congress.
